Mississippi HB645 prohibits COVID-19 mRNA vaccinations until the State Department of Health determines they are safe.
Mississippi HB645 mandates that the administration of COVID-19 mRNA vaccinations is prohibited until the State Department of Health analyzes existing data and concludes that the benefits outweigh the risks. The Department must conduct a study and make recommendations on the benefits and risks of the vaccinations, including a self-controlled case series within one year. Only if the Department determines the vaccinations are safe may their use continue. This act takes effect immediately upon passage.
